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.
Minimal lib currently doesn't support multicolor substruct matches.

Describe the solution you'd like
Unsure of the implementation but either an option to have a color per bond and atom like in the getting started of RDKit https://www.rdkit.org/docs/GettingStartedInPython.html.

OR

An option to do color matching per structure match in SMILES/SMARTS strings containing dot notation.

OR

An option to map substructure match with their desired colour.

Describe alternatives you've considered
Server-side rendering with main RDKit, it'd be simple to have that in the MinimalLib for heavy users of RDKit.js or other distribution of the minimallib.
